Minnesota Timberwolves Betting Preview

The Minnesota Timberwolves lost to the Hawks, beat the Bulls, and they play the Wizards next. The Timberwolves have won 11 of their last 16 games.

The Minnesota Timberwolves are averaging 118.5 points on 47.6 percent shooting and allowing 113.5 points on 45.5 percent shooting. Anthony Edwards is averaging 28.7 points and 5 rebounds, while Julius Randle is averaging 22.6 points and 5.5 assists. Jaden McDaniels is the third double-digit scorer, and Donte DiVincenzo is grabbing 4.3 rebounds. The Minnesota Timberwolves are shooting 37 percent from beyond the arc and 75.9 percent from the free-throw line. The Minnesota Timberwolves are allowing 34.9 percent shooting from deep and are grabbing 44.3 rebounds per game.

Miami Heat Betting Preview

The Miami Heat beat the Nuggets and Pistons, and they play the Pelicans next. The Heat have won 4 straight games.

The Miami Heat are averaging 119.2 points on 47 percent shooting and allowing 117.6 points on 45.2 percent shooting. Norman Powell is averaging 23.7 points and 3.9 rebounds, while Tyler Herro is averaging 23.2 points and 2.3 assists. Bam Adebayo is the third double-digit scorer, and Jaime Jaquez Jr. is grabbing 5.5 rebounds. The Miami Heat are shooting 36.7 percent from beyond the arc and 78.2 percent from the free-throw line. The Miami Heat are allowing 34.5 percent shooting from deep and are grabbing 45.4 rebounds per game.

Heat vs Timberwolves Injury Report

The Heat will be without Terry Rozier and Tyler Herro. Pelle Larsson is questionable.

The Timberwolves will be without Terrence Shannon Jr.
